Using hand held e-business tools is likely to be carried out under routine supervision within enterprise guidelines.

This unit covers the use of hand held tools for e-business and defines the standard required to: use relevant technology to support business operations; enter and process data according to technical and business requirements; generate data in the format required by the e-business supply chain.

Required skills

follow protocols for equipment use and data storage

use relevant e-business technology

generate data in the format required by the e-business supply chain

print reports as required

use literacy skills to read, interpret and follow organisational policies and procedures, follow sequenced written instructions, record accurately and legible information collected and select and apply procedures for a range of tasks

use oral communication skills/language competence to fulfil the job role as specified by the organisation, including questioning techniques, active listening, clarifying information and consulting with supervisors as required

use numeracy skills to estimate, calculate and record routine workplace measures

use interpersonal skills to work with and relate to people from a range of cultural, social and religious backgrounds and with a range of physical and mental abilities.

Required knowledge

operating procedures of relevant business tools

relevant protocols for electronic data interchange

personal identification and password for online access between businesses for access to inventory data and purchasing, payment or supply processes.

The range statement relates to the unit of competency as a whole.

E-business tools may include:

computers

personal data assistants (PDAs)

radio frequency (RF) scanners

microchip scanners

mobile phone enabled email and SMS

data recording devices

barcoding equipment.

E-business tools are selected according to requirements of the task and business practices. 
Relevant start-up procedures are completed in accordance with technical and business requirements. 
Tools are configured with relevant business data as required. 
Connectivity is tested, as required, according to technical and business requirements. 
E-business tools are used according to technical and business requirements. 
Equipment faults are addressed, as required, according to technical and business requirements. 
Data is checked for accuracy and errors are addressed, as required, according to technical and business requirements. 
Business data is generated and compiled, as required, with reference to technical and business requirements. 
Business data is processed according to technical and business requirements. 
Procedures to maintain the integrity of data and data security are followed. 
Performance of hand held e-business tools is reviewed and recommendations made for improvements to hardware, software and/or their use in accordance with e-business strategy and budget.
